Vermont sports betting volume to reach $18.4 in November

According to the Vermont Department of Alcoholic Beverages and Lottery, sports betting volume in November was $18.4 million, up 6.3 percent from October’s $17.3 million.

Revenue was $2.05 million, up 94 percent from October’s $1.06 million. Football brought in $6.2 million, basketball $5 million, tennis $950,000, soccer $730,162, and table tennis $576,349.

Of the total bets, $13.8 million was in-state and $4.5 million was out-of-state. The number of active out-of-state users dropped to 10,862, while in-state users increased to 17,545 from 16,790 in October. The average bet increased to $23 from $21 month-over-month.
